From 44eb61321f0caf2e9e719c71a2c44e6c12b1200d Mon Sep 17 00:00:00 2001 From: BINDUCHAITANYA TUMMALA Date: Thu, 29 Aug 2013 16:58:26 +0530 Subject: [PATCH] Change for alert popup with scrollable label Change-Id: I87c956d39b55d5141d226c993c04008dea83693c Signed-off-by: BINDUCHAITANYA TUMMALA --- src/controls/FWebCtrl_UserConfirmPopup.cpp | 103 +++++++++++++++++++++++++---- 1 file changed, 90 insertions(+), 13 deletions(-) diff --git a/src/controls/FWebCtrl_UserConfirmPopup.cpp b/src/controls/FWebCtrl_UserConfirmPopup.cpp index 524926c..ef242a3 100755 --- a/src/controls/FWebCtrl_UserConfirmPopup.cpp +++ b/src/controls/FWebCtrl_UserConfirmPopup.cpp @@ -25,6 +25,7 @@ #include #include #include +#include #include #include #include @@ -32,9 +33,12 @@ #include #include #include +#include #include #include #include +#include +#include #include #include #include @@ -49,6 +53,7 @@ using namespace Tizen::Base; using namespace Tizen::Base::Collection; using namespace Tizen::Base::Utility; using namespace Tizen::Graphics; +using namespace Tizen::Graphics::_Text; using namespace Tizen::Io; using namespace Tizen::Security::Cert; using namespace Tizen::System; @@ -60,6 +65,9 @@ namespace Tizen { namespace Web { namespace Controls { +static const int TEXT_SIZE_ADJUST = 1; + + _UserConfirmPopup::_UserConfirmPopup(void) : __pUserPolicyData(null) , __userConfirmMode(USER_CONFIRM_USERMEDIA) @@ -126,15 +134,6 @@ _UserConfirmPopup::Construct(_UserConfirmMode userConfirmMode, void* pEventInfo, SetTitleText(pSysResource->GetString(_RESOURCE_DOMAIN_ID_OSP, "IDS_TPLATFORM_HEADER_SECURITY_WARNING_ABB")); } - Rectangle rect(0, 0, 0, 0); - - //label - rect.height = 2*pPopupData->labelDim.height; - rect.width = pPopupData->labelDim.width; - - std::unique_ptr